Dr. Erica Volker is an Instructor of Clinical Ophthalmology at Yale School of Medicine. She specializes in comprehensive eye exams, spectacle corrections, and fitting specialty contact lenses for complex conditions such as keratoconus, post-refractive surgery, and pediatric aphakia. Her clinical practice emphasizes improving patient quality of life through advanced contact lens solutions. Dr. Volker earned her BA and OD from the University of California, Berkeley, and completed a residency in ocular disease at Bascom Palmer Eye Institute.
Education:
- Bachelor of Arts (Molecular and Cell Biology), UC Berkeley (2004)
- Doctor of Optometry (O.D.), UC Berkeley (2010)
- Residency in Ocular Disease, Bascom Palmer Eye Institute (2011)
Research & Clinical Focus: Dr. Volker’s expertise lies in specialty contact lens fitting for corneal irregularities (e.g., keratoconus, post-corneal graft) and refractive challenges. She advocates for personalized solutions to enhance ocular comfort and visual acuity. Her work with scleral lenses highlights innovative approaches to complex cases.
